vivacity
noun
/vɪˈvæsɪti/
Meaning
The quality of being lively, animated, and full of energy.
Example Sentences
The child’s
vivacity
brightened the entire room.
Synonyms
liveliness, energy, animation, spirit
Antonyms
dullness, lethargy, lifelessness
Collocations
with vivacity, full of vivacity, natural vivacity
